Bamieh
Bamieh refer to Iranian's special crispy fried sweets made from a yogurt batter and soaked in syrup which looks a bit like okra pods hence it is called as such. Bahmieh is served during the Ramadan, when the people are already allowed to eat after fasting.
Bamieh is a Persian dessert that look like mini or small Churros, but are nutty tasting and slightly heavier. Also soaked in a sugar syrup or honey.
Churros is from Spain.
